At Ace Elder Care 1, the monthly costs for care reflect a competitive pricing structure in comparison to both Boundary County and the broader state of Idaho. For a semi-private room, the cost is $2,000, which aligns with the local county average but is significantly more affordable than the state average of $3,026. Similarly, for private rooms, Ace Elder Care 1 offers rates at $2,500 - again matching Boundary County's pricing while remaining substantially lower than Idaho's average of $3,906. This positioning not only makes Ace Elder Care 1 an attractive option for families seeking quality elder care but also highlights its commitment to providing accessible and affordable services within the community.
